Time needed: 3 minutes

This is how to reset your service warning light on your Nissan NV200. We’re going to be using the ❏ left-hand knob. We’re gonna be twisting it to scroll and pressing it to select. So let me do that right now.

  1. Turn ignition switch to the on position

    We’re not going to be starting the vehicle up, so turn the key until you get to on position

  2. Go to the SETTINGS

    Then from where it is, press the left knob until it comes around to SETTINGS

  3. Scroll to DETAIL

    From there we go twist the knob clockwise to DETAIL and press the knob to get in

  4. Go down to the MAINTENANCE

    After that, you’ll come up with the settings menu. So turning it clockwise to go down to the MAINTENANCE and you press it

  5. Highlight SERVICE

    Now you twist the knob clockwise again to go to SERVICE 

  6. Press and hold the left knob

    At this time you need to hold down the knob on the service and it will come up with the Reset option

  7. Select RESET and then Confirm

    Next, select RESET and confirm it to perform the service reset

For your info, this operation work for the first generation of the Nissan NV200 (2013, 2014, 2015, 2016, 2017, 2018, 2019, 2020, 2021 model years).
